随着互联网技术的飞速发展,Web应用已经成为人们日常生活中不可或缺的一部分。从购物、社交到办公、娱乐,Web应用已经渗透到我们生活的方方面面。那么,Web应用开发有哪些现代化趋势呢?本文将带您一起探讨。
一、前端技术日新月异
1. 响应式设计成为主流(响应式设计)
随着移动设备的普及,响应式设计已经成为Web应用开发的重要趋势。通过响应式设计,Web应用可以适应不同设备的屏幕尺寸,为用户提供更好的使用体验。
2. 前端框架层出不穷(前端框架)
从Bootstrap到Vue.js,前端框架的发展日新月异。这些框架可以帮助开发者快速构建高质量的Web应用,提高开发效率。
3. PWA(Progressive Web Apps)崛起(PWA)
PWA是一种新的Web应用开发模式,它结合了Web和原生应用的优势。PWA应用可以在无网络环境下使用,并且可以像原生应用一样推送通知。
二、后端技术持续演进
1. 微服务架构兴起(微服务架构)
微服务架构将一个大型的Web应用拆分成多个独立的小型服务,每个服务负责特定的功能。这种架构提高了应用的扩展性和可维护性。
2. 容器化技术广泛应用(容器化技术)
容器化技术,如Docker,可以将应用及其运行环境打包成一个独立的容器。这使得Web应用可以在不同的环境中快速部署和运行。
3. 云原生应用逐渐普及(云原生应用)
云原生应用是专为云环境设计的应用,它可以充分利用云平台的资源,提高应用的性能和可扩展性。
三、数据驱动与人工智能
1. 大数据分析助力Web应用优化(大数据分析)
通过大数据分析,开发者可以了解用户行为,优化Web应用的功能和性能。
2. 人工智能技术融入Web应用(人工智能)
人工智能技术,如自然语言处理、图像识别等,已经广泛应用于Web应用中,为用户提供更加智能化的服务。
Web应用开发正朝着前端技术、后端技术、数据驱动和人工智能等多个方向发展。作为开发者,我们需要紧跟这些趋势,不断提升自己的技能,为用户提供更好的Web应用体验。
还没有评论,来说两句吧...